About Megaparsec (Mpc)

Definition

The megaparsec is equal to one million parsecs, approximately 3.26 million light-years, used for measuring distances between galaxies and in cosmology.

Mathematical Relationship

1 Mpc = 10⁶ pc = 3.0857 × 10²² m ≈ 3.262 × 10⁶ light-years.

Conversion Formula

To convert Mpc to light-years: multiply by 3.262 × 10⁶. To convert Mpc to meters: multiply by 3.0857 × 10²².

Practical Applications

Measuring distances to galaxy clusters, Hubble flow calculations, and large-scale structure mapping.

Interesting Facts

The Andromeda Galaxy is about 0.78 Mpc away. The Virgo Cluster is about 16.5 Mpc distant.

Common Mistakes

Confusing Mpc with kpc — they differ by a factor of 1,000. kpc = within galaxies, Mpc = between galaxies.

Educational Tips

Hubble's constant links distance (Mpc) to recession speed (km/s): the farther away a galaxy is, the faster it recedes.

About Picometer (pm)

Definition

The picometer is a unit of length equal to 10⁻¹² meters, or one trillionth of a meter.

Mathematical Relationship

1 pm = 10⁻¹² m = 0.01 Å = 1,000 fm. One nanometer equals 1,000 picometers.

Conversion Formula

To convert pm to meters: multiply by 10⁻¹². To convert pm to angstroms: divide by 100.

Practical Applications

Expressing covalent bond lengths (e.g., C–C bond ≈ 154 pm), atomic radii, and crystal lattice spacings.

Interesting Facts

The hydrogen atom has a radius of about 53 pm (the Bohr radius), while a carbon-carbon single bond is about 154 pm long.

Common Mistakes

Mixing up picometers and nanometers — remember 1 nm = 1,000 pm. Some sources still use the deprecated angstrom.

Educational Tips

Think of pm as the natural unit for atoms: most atomic radii fall between 30 pm and 300 pm.
